dc.description.abstract | ERL 89 is located 130 km SSE of Darwin, NT, and 5 km NW of the Cosmopolitan Howley Gold Mine. It covers a sector of the Howley Anticline, a complex regional fold within South Alligator Group sediments of Lower Proterozoic age. The structure strikes and plunges shallow north-westerly within the tenement and in the region hosts a number of important gold deposits, including the Chinese 1, 2 and 3 deposits, the Big Howley deposit, and the major Cosmo Howley deposit. Previous exploration by Northern Gold N.L. comprised geochemical sampling and RC drilling. The work concentrated on the South Ridge Prospect, a 2 km long mineralised zone coincident with the Howley Anticlinal structure and along strike from the Big Howley open pit. An inferred resource of 204,000 t at 2.4 g/t Au was estimated at South Ridge by Northern Gold N.L and an ERL was applied for to protect the then sub economic resource. In April 2002 Territory Goldfields NL and Buffalo Creek Mines NL entered into a joint venture that merged certain tenement assets within a 30 km radius of the gold treatment plant at Brocks Creek and included ERL 89. In August 2004 the joint venture negotiated the sale of the Brocks Creek mill to Tanami Gold NL and simultaneously purchased the mill at Union Reefs in a dealing with AngloGold (Ashanti). At a rated 2.4 Mt per annum, the Union Reefs mill is larger than the original Brocks Creek facility and can more economically treat lower grade gold ores. It also requires very little lead time before start up. The South Ridge resources and extensions to the Big Howley pit have been the subject of technical reviews as part of the overall assessment of advanced stage gold deposits in the Burnside region. This review factored in the economic impact of the Union Reefs mill purchase and movements in the Australian gold price. The review concluded that the South Ridge and Big Howley extension rank low compared to other deposits along the trend that have been drilled by the Burnside Joint Venture. The Burnside Joint Venture will continue resource reviews on South Ridge in ERL 89 as part of the overall resource reassessment of the Burnside region. It has been recognised that the South Ridge inferred resource is narrow (1-4m) and has a lower priority ranking than other deposits in the Joint Venture area. The purchase of the Union Reef mill is expected to escalate the scheduling of the better grade open pit deposits in the Burnside Region. Expenditure on the tenement will have a lower priority until treatment is renewed at Union Reefs and MLNA 1129 is approved. Infill RC drilling will be required at some stage to upgrade the resource to indicated. | en_US |
